Bollywood Hungama has been tracking the domestic collections of Radhe – Your Most Wanted Bhai since the time it was released on Eid 2021, that is, on May 13. In the first week, it was released in just three cinemas in Tripura. Later, as cinemas opened in different states, it got a release in Maharashtra followed by Gujarat. The collections were poor but yet, it was heartening to see a small number of people going for a film that is easily available on the internet and has been panned on social media.

 

Radhe Box Office: The Salman Khan starrer collects Rs. 1.71 lakhs in 7th weekend; collections on Bakri Eid expected to be even better

 

Last week, we reported that Radhe – Your Most Wanted Bhai collected just Rs. 3,561 in the sixth weekend. But then, it got a new lease of life as it was released in the iconic Raj Mandir cinema in Jaipur, Rajasthan. The film attracted nearly 150-200 people daily after its screening began on Tuesday, July 13. And the good performance continued over the weekend as well.

 

Moreover, Radhe – Your Most Wanted Bhai also got a release in Uttar Pradesh towns like Kanpur, Varanasi and Aligarh from Friday where it did well. Sadly, due to the weekend curfew in Uttar Pradesh, the film wasn’t screened in these three cities on Saturday and Sunday. Also, the rains in Jaipur on Saturday affected the collections a bit. But it has made it clear that viewers would come to catch the film on weekdays, especially on Wednesday, July 21, the day of Bakri Eid. There are also reports that more cities in the northern state will play Radhe – Your Most Wanted Bhai from Monday, July 19.

 

A trade expert told Bollywood Hungama, “Radhe – Your Most Wanted Bhai collected around Rs. 96,508 on Friday, Rs. 30,000 on Saturday and Rs. 45,186 on Sunday. These are approximate figures.” The collections of Radhe – Your Most Wanted Bhai now stand at Rs. 4,40,385.

 

The seventh weekend collections have been record-breaking for Radhe – Your Most Wanted Bhai. The amount it has earned in the last 3 days (Rs. 1,71,694) is the highest it has accumulated in a week. In fact, its Friday collections of Rs. 96,508 is higher than what the film collected in its best weeks, in Week 1 (Rs. 63,248) and Week 6 (Rs. 87,302). Had there been no curfew in the weekends in Uttar Pradesh, the collections would have surely zoomed past the Rs. 1 lakh mark on both Saturday and Sunday.

 


 

Even on social media, Radhe – Your Most Wanted Bhai was making some sort of noise as viewers posted pictures of the tickets, posters outside the theatre and even reactions to certain scenes in the theatre. All eyes are now on weekdays, especially on Bakri Eid, when the collections are expected to be much better.

 

Meanwhile, the collections of Radhe – Your Most Wanted Bhai at The Friday Cinema multiplex in Surat, Gujarat continue to be poor and the film’s run there would end on Thursday, July 22.

 


 

Radhe India box office summary at a glance

 

Week 1 (released in Agartala and Dharmanagar in Tripura)

 

Day 1 [13 May] – Rs. 10,432

 

Day 2 [14 May] – Rs. 22,518

 

Day 3 [15 May] - Rs. 13,485

 

Day 4 [16 May] - Rs. 13,485

 

Day 5 [17 May] - Rs. 1,155

 

Day 6 [18 May] – Rs. 1,155

 

Day 7 [19 May] - Rs. 509

 

Day 8 [20 May] - Rs. 509

 

Total – Rs. 63,248

 

Week 2 (released in Malegaon and Aurangabad in Maharashtra)

 

Day 9 [11 June] – Rs. 6,018

 

Day 10 [12 June] - Rs. 5,445

 

Day 11 [13 June] - Rs. 6,229

 

Day 12 [14 June] – Rs. 4,460

 

Day 13 [15 June] - Rs. 2,986

 

Day 14 [16 June] - Rs. 2,602

 

Day 15 [17 June] - Rs. 2,403

 

Total – Rs. 30,143

 

Week 3 (retained in Aurangabad in Maharashtra)

 

Day 16 [18 June] - Rs. 2,203

 

Day 17 [19 June] - Rs. 2,754

 

Day 18 [20 June] - Rs. 6,059

 

Day 19 [21 June] - Rs. 1,653

 

Day 20 [22 June] - Rs. 3,856

 

Day 21 [23 June] - Rs. 2,424

 

Day 22 [24 June] - Rs. 2,864

 

Total – Rs. 21,813

 

Week 4 (ran in Aurangabad in Maharashtra till the weekend; released in Gujarat from Sunday onwards)

 

Day 23 [25 June] - Rs. 2,864

 

Day 24 [26 June] - Rs. 881

 

Day 25 [27 June] - Rs. 10,471

 

Day 26 [28 June] - Rs. 7,626

 

Day 27 [29 June] - Rs. 5,018

 

Day 28 [30 June] - Rs. 4,706

 

Day 29 [1 July] - Rs. 5,950

 

Total – Rs. 37,516

 

Week 5 (retained in Gujarat)

 

Day 30 [2 July] - Rs. 3,732

 

Day 31 [3 July] - Rs. 2,219

 

Day 32 [4 July] - Rs. 12,219

 

Day 33 [5 July] - Rs. 4,263

 

Day 34 [6 July] - Rs. 1,598

 

Day 35 [7 July] - Rs. 2,022

 

Day 36 [8 July] - Rs. 2,616

 

Total – Rs. 28,669

 

Week 6 (retained in Gujarat; released in Rajasthan from Tuesday)

 

Day 37 [9 July] - Rs. 1,258

 

Day 38 [10 July] - Rs. 1,374

 

Day 39 [11 July] - Rs. 929

 

Day 40 [12 July] - Rs. 1,232

 

Day 41 [13 July] - Rs. 25,216

 

Day 42 [14 July] - Rs. 25,321

 

Day 43 [15 July] - Rs. 31,972

 

Total – Rs. 87,302

 

Week 7 (retained in Gujarat and Rajasthan; released in Uttar Pradesh)

 

Day 44 [16 July] - Rs. 96,508

 

Day 45 [17 July] - Rs. 30,000

 

Day 46 [18 July] - Rs. 45,186

 

Total – Rs. 1,71,694

 

GRAND TOTAL (till date) – Rs. 4,40,385
